ArcGIS Pipeline Referencing features and specs

  • Comprehensive Integration
    ArcGIS Pipeline Referencing seamlessly integrates with the ArcGIS platform, allowing users to leverage spatial analysis, mapping, and data visualization capabilities effectively.
  • Enhanced Data Management
    The tool provides robust management of linear referencing systems, making it easier to maintain accurate pipeline data in alignment with real-world locations and measurements.
  • Efficient Data Maintenance
    ArcGIS Pipeline Referencing reduces the complexity of maintaining pipeline data by simplifying how information is updated and ensuring that all data is synchronized across the system.
  • Increased Operational Efficiency
    By providing high-quality, precise data, the tool supports better decision-making, reduces operational risks, and increases the efficiency of workflows involving pipeline management.
  • Advanced Visualization
    Users can visualize pipeline data in 2D and 3D, offering better insights into geographical and infrastructural contexts for planning and analysis.

Possible disadvantages of ArcGIS Pipeline Referencing

  • Cost
    ArcGIS Pipeline Referencing is part of the ArcGIS suite, which is a commercial software, potentially making it expensive for small organizations or those with limited budgets.
  • Learning Curve
    Given its comprehensive capabilities, new users might face a steep learning curve, requiring significant training and familiarization with the system.
  • Complexity
    The tool's extensive features and integration capabilities can introduce complexity, potentially overwhelming users without a strong background in GIS technology.
  • Resource Intensive
    Running the software efficiently may require substantial computational resources, such as advanced hardware setups and IT infrastructure.
  • Dependency on Esri Ecosystem
    As part of the Esri ecosystem, users might face challenges integrating other non-Esri tools or migrating data if they plan to shift away from Esri products in the future.
